Engine Features

The GSX-8R’s new-generation 776cc parallel-twin DOHC engine delivers a superb balance of smooth, controllable, torque-rich power from low RPM and freely revs up to its peak power output.

The 270-degree crankshaft configuration provides a power delivery and distinctive exhaust rumble like the 90-degree V-twin engine used in other Suzuki models.

Suzuki Cross Balancer technology, patented by Suzuki, and used for the first time on a production motorcycle, helps create a compact, lightweight design that delivers smooth operation.

The unique cooling system inlet control thermostat valve helps maintain consistent engine temperature and smooths the idle speed during warm-up. This helps stabilize combustion and helps to reduce exhaust emissions.

Transmission Features

The six-speed transmission features gear ratios that deliver exciting acceleration, whether shifting normally or when using the standard-equipment Bi-directional Quick Shift System, enabling the rider to shift without clutch operation.

The transmission’s output is managed by the Suzuki Clutch Assist System (SCAS). This system works like a slipper clutch by allowing a small amount of clutch slip for smoother downshifts.

The SCAS also works as an assist clutch, increasing plate pressure under acceleration, but always helping keep the clutch lever’s pull light and precise.

Riding on durable steel sprockets, a strong O-ring style drive chain contains lubrication pre-packed between the pins and rollers for quiet, reliable operation.

Chassis Features

Dual front brakes with 310mm diameter discs and radially mounted NISSIN® four-piston calipers help provide strong and consistent stopping power.

The Showa® SFF-BP (Separate Function Fork – Big Piston) inverted fork has 41mm inner tubes with 5.1 inches (130 mm) of smooth travel helping deliver a comfortable and controlled ride.

The link-type rear suspension with a Showa® mono-shock is tuned for superb straight-line performance and corning agility, even when carrying a passenger.

Matched to the GSX-8R’s chassis geometry and suspension is a uniquely shaped aluminum swingarm that enhances vertical, lateral, and torsional rigidity aiding straight-line andcornering performance.

Electrical Features

The GSX-8R instrument panel uses a full-color, five-inch TFT LCD screen. This high-quality instrument panel is set into the inner fairing above the separate handlebars, for good visibility and protection from road debris.

S-DMS provides the rider with a choice of three different engine power output modes. Working in concert with the Traction Control System*, S-DMS permits peak power in each mode while changing the nature of the power delivery.

The electronic throttle system uses the capability of the GSX-8R’s 32-bit, dual-processor ECM, and CAN-bus wire harness to convert throttle grip movement and sensor input into instantaneous and precise throttle plate movement in the two 42mm throttle bodies.

The GSX-8R is equipped with a smooth Bi-directional Quick Shift System, The Suzuki Easy Start System, and The Low RPM Assist System.

Specifications

Engine

Engine - 776cc, 4-stroke, liquid-cooled, DOHC parallel twin

Bore x Stroke - 84.0 mm x 70 mm (3.3 in. x 2.8 in.)

Compression Ratio - 12.8:1

Fuel System - Fuel injection

Starter - Electric

Lubrication - Force-fed circulation, wet sump

Drivetrain

Clutch - Wet, multi-plate type

Transmission - 6-speed constant mesh

Final Drive - O-ring style drive chain, 525 x 118L

Chassis

Suspension Front - SHOWA inverted telescopic, coil spring, oil damped

Suspension Rear - SHOWA link type, single shock, coil spring, oil damped

Brakes Front - NISSIN, Radial-mount 4-piston calipers, twin disc, ABS-equipped

Brakes Rear - NISSIN, 1-piston caliper, single disc, ABS-equipped

Tires Front - 120/70ZR17M/C (58W), tubeless

Tires Rear - 180/55ZR17M/C (73W), tubeless

Fuel Tank Capacity - 14.0 L (3.7 US gal.)

Colour - Metallic Triton Blue, Metallic Matte Sword Silver, or Pearl Ignite Yellow

Electrical

Ignition - Electronic ignition (transistorized)

Spark Plug - Iridium type x 2

Headlight - Mono-focus LED x 2

Tail Light – LED

Dimensions

Overall Length - 2115 mm (83.3 in.)

Overall Width - 770 mm (30.3 in.)

Overall Height - 1135 mm (44.7 in.)

Wheelbase - 1465 mm (57.7 in.)

Ground Clearance - 145 mm (5.7 in.)

Seat Height - 810 mm (31.9 in.)

Curb Weight - 205 kg (452 lb.)
